Understanding Waystones and Their Purpose
Before we dive into the crafting specifics, let’s clarify what Waystones are. It’s important to realise that Waystones are not a part of vanilla Minecraft; they are added through the popular “Waystones” mod by BlayTheNth. This mod introduces special blocks that, once activated, allow players to instantly teleport between them. Imagine placing a Waystone at your main base, another at your favourite diamond mine, and a third at a crucial farming area. With a simple click, you can jump between these locations, saving countless hours of travel time. This makes them indispensable for large builds, extensive exploration, and managing multiple bases.
Crafting Your First Waystone: The Waystone Minecraft Recipe
Now for the exciting part – learning the actual waystone Minecraft recipe! Crafting a Waystone is relatively straightforward, requiring a few common materials and one slightly rarer item. You’ll need a crafting table to put it all together. Once you have the ingredients, the process is quick and simple.
Gathering the Materials
To craft a standard Waystone, you will need the following:
- 3 Stone Bricks: These are made by smelting Cobblestone in a furnace to get Stone, then crafting four Stone blocks into four Stone Bricks.
- 3 Ender Pearls: Dropped by Endermen. These creatures typically spawn in dark areas at night or in The End dimension.
- 1 Block of Lapis Lazuli: Crafted from nine Lapis Lazuli gems, which are found by mining Lapis Lazuli Ore deep underground.
Assembling the Recipe
Once you have all your materials, open your crafting table and arrange them as follows:
- Place one Stone Brick in the top-centre slot.
- Place one Ender Pearl in the middle-left slot.
- Place the Block of Lapis Lazuli in the exact centre slot.
- Place one Ender Pearl in the middle-right slot.
- Place one Stone Brick in the bottom-left slot.
- Place one Stone Brick in the bottom-right slot.
The remaining slots (top-left, top-right, and bottom-centre) should be empty. This specific arrangement will yield one Waystone block!
Activating and Using Your Waystone
After successfully crafting your Waystone, the next step is to place and activate it. Simply place the Waystone block anywhere you desire, just like any other block. Once placed, right-click on it to open its interface. Here, you can give your Waystone a unique name, which is incredibly helpful for identifying different locations. All Waystones you place and activate will automatically appear in a list when you interact with any other Waystone, allowing for seamless teleportation between them. Tips for Effective Waystone Use:
- Strategic Placement: Place Waystones at key locations such as your main base, important mining shafts, mob farms, villages, and the portals to the Nether or The End.
- Clear Naming: Use descriptive names like “Main Base,” “Diamond Mine Lvl 12,” or “Desert Temple” to easily navigate your network.
- Personal vs. Global: Be aware that some Waystone mods have options for personal Waystones (only you can use) or global Waystones (anyone can use). Check your mod’s configuration!
- Early Game Advantage: Prioritise getting a Waystone early on. It will drastically cut down travel time and make early game exploration much more efficient.

Frequently Asked Questions
Q: Is the Waystone a vanilla Minecraft item?
A: No, Waystones are not part of the standard Minecraft game. They are added through a popular modification (mod), most commonly the “Waystones” mod by BlayTheNth.
Q: What mod do I need for the Waystone Minecraft recipe?
A: You’ll typically need to install the “Waystones” mod by BlayTheNth to access the Waystone functionality and recipe.
Q: Can I move a Waystone after placing it?
A: Generally, no. Once a Waystone is placed, breaking it will destroy the item, and you’ll need to craft a new one. Plan your placement carefully!
Q: Do Waystones require power or fuel to work?
A: In the standard “Waystones” mod, they do not require any power or fuel to function. Once placed and activated, they are ready for use.
Q: How do I link Waystones together?
A: Waystones automatically link to each other once they are placed and activated. When you interact with any Waystone, you’ll see a list of all other activated Waystones in your world.
